ballpoint
/ˈbɔlˌpɔɪnt/
noun
- A pen that uses a small ball bearing to roll ink onto paper; a ballpoint pen.
- I prefer writing with a ballpoint because it doesn't smudge.
- The store sells ballpoints in many different colors.
- He clicked his ballpoint and started filling out the form.
adjective
- Describing a pen that uses a ball bearing and thick ink.
- Ballpoint ink dries faster than fountain pen ink.
- She bought a ballpoint pen from the stationery shop.
- My favorite ballpoint refill is the blue medium tip.
